What to Look For
- Strong odor control via sealed chambers or carbon filters.
- Sensors that pause cycles when a cat is inside.
- Easy-to-clean liners or washable parts.
- Clear app notifications for waste drawer levels.
What to Avoid
- Models with narrow entryways that stress larger cats.
- Units requiring proprietary litter that inflates long-term costs.
- Cheap no-name devices lacking safety sensors.

FAQ
Are automatic litter boxes safe for kittens?
Most require cats to weigh at least 3–5 pounds before use; check each model’s minimum weight setting.
How often do I empty the waste drawer?
Expect to empty every 5–10 days for one cat, depending on usage and model capacity.
Do they use a lot of electricity?
Typical draw is under 5 watts during cycles, similar to a small lamp.
